Oil-free compressors eliminate the risk of oil contamination in the compressed air, ensuring the purity of the end product and reducing maintenance costs.
Oil-free compressors are designed to operate efficiently, minimizing energy consumption and reducing overall operating costs.
With no oil lubricant, oil-free compressors produce clean and environmentally friendly compressed air, making them ideal for applications that require strict air quality standards.
Oil-free compressors require less maintenance compared to oil-lubricated compressors, resulting in lower maintenance costs and increased uptime.
Oil-free compressors are often compact in size, allowing for easy installation and integration into existing systems or limited space environments.
Oil-free compressors operate using a dry compression technique. Instead of oil lubrication, they rely on advanced sealing mechanisms and materials to ensure the compression process is free from oil contamination.
Evaluate the specific air flow requirements of your application to determine the appropriate capacity of the oil-free compressor.
Identify the maximum pressure needed for your application and select an oil-free compressor that can reliably deliver that pressure.
If noise is a concern in your facility, choose an oil-free compressor with noise reduction features to ensure a quieter working environment.
Take into account the operating temperature, humidity, and other environmental conditions to choose an oil-free compressor that can perform optimally in your specific conditions.
Opt for oil-free compressors that have energy efficiency certifications, such as ENERGY STAR, to ensure you are getting a compressor that meets high energy-saving standards.
When installing an oil-free compressor, it is essential to follow the manufacturer’s instructions and guidelines. Ensure proper ventilation, electrical connections, and regular maintenance to maximize performance and longevity.
